What a wonderful smell the first rains bring. After two Photographic Safaris in the Khwai/Savuti and the Kgalagadi we are back in Maun to get ready to do a bit of water-work on the Chobe River.
The Khwai delivered as usual. Lions, four leopard sightings in one day, sixteen wild dogs in our camp all rounded off by the amazing food of Capture Africa. Temperatures rising into the forties, were making all species head down to the water allowing for amazing photography.
The long haul down to the Kgalagadi was as usual also unbelievable. Lots of lions and birds of prey, as well as sad moments where a lion pride killed two cheetahs overnight. They were probably unexpectedly ambushed after drinking water at the KijKij waterhole.
The first rain was short but the smell was something indescribable.
